Search Specialist, Large Customer Sales at Google

Google · London, United Kingdom · Onsite

Minimum q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ree or equivalent practical experience.
  • 11 years of experience in search and performance advertising, consultative sales, business development, online media environment, AI, or marketing role.
  • Experience identifying client’s issues to defining customer and product strategy, enabling long-term opportunities.
  • Experience working with digital organizations.

Preferred qualifications:

  • Understanding of Demand Led Growth principles.
  • Understanding of the role search and PMax plays in the performance marketing funnel.
  • Ability to influence executive-level stakeholders with objectives to address customer product needs and close agreements.

Responsibilities

  • Manage relationships with existing clients while developing a thorough understanding of their business objectives, goals and issues.
  • Leverage knowledge of search and performance products to help unlock demanded growth for advertisers, aligned with their business objectives.
  • Identify and pursue search, pmax and applications growth opportunities across top advertisers, prioritize accounts, manage objections, position Google and evaluate campaign effectiveness.
  • Consult with C-level clients to achieve business and marketing goals, utilizing Google’s marketing solutions suite, specifically application advertising.
  • Contribute to the development of our performance solutions by partnering with product leads in the EMEA region to provide feedback on top customer objections.
